Shrink Nanotechnologies Establishes New Subsidiary Shrink Solar

Nanotechnology company Shrink Nanotechnologies, Inc. has established a new completely owned subsidiary Shrink Solar LLC, which focuses on commercializing the company’s solar technologies. Shrink Nanotechnologies licenses opportunities and develops products in the solar power generation; biotechnology and sensors R&D tools; and medical diagnostics businesses.

The solar concentrator designs of Shrink Nanotechnologies will now be available through Shrink Solar and will enable consumers to generate solar energy with the help of their windows and rooftops.

Shrink Nanotechnologies’ CEO Mark L. Baum stated that the goal of Shrink Solar is to play a crucial part in the solar power generation market valued at $37 billion by developing and selling cost-effective solar concentrators as an add-on device to already existing poly- and mono-crystalline solar cell arrays in order to generate more energy output for every square meter.

Utilizing the patent-pending nanocrystal-based technology of Shrink Solar, the technologies of Shrink Nanotechnologies enhance the capability of silicon in absorbing sunlight and converting it to electrical energy.
